I have a Galaxy S21 Ultra. Latest software updates. Bank with Barclays and
have the latest version of that App software too. Which seems to work just
fine - can do transfers and payments, etc.

And touch payment used to work - up until a couple of months ago. NFC is
on and the Barclay App selected.

If going to touch payment setup in the App I get 'Unfortunately you can't
make contactless payments with this device"

Which is obviously a lie since it did work until recently.

I've tried Barclays online chat and phoning them. Both seemed to be manned
by those without an answer and say they'll pass it on for advice and a
solution - but never do.

Any hints where to get an answer? I've tried an un install, deleting the
Barclays details, and starting over, with no success.

IME you need to have enabled contactless payment in the app recently -
if you leave it too many days before using it again it turns itself off.
(you also need NFC turned on in the phone settings). You normally need
to see the contactless icon on the status bar:
